A mixture of 2-chloro-5-methylpyrimidine (1 g, 7.78 mmol) and ammonium hydroxide (18.26 mL, 469 mmol) was heated at 85 ¡ãC in a sealed tube for 18 h. The mixture was cooled to rt and and then ice/water bath, and filtered. The white filter cake was washed with hexanes and suction dried.LCMS (method C ) tR,0.33 min., MH+ = 110.2
